What does a King's Commissioner?

(Commissaris Van De Koning) The King's Commissioner (CdK) is the figurehead and chair of the provincial government and fulfills a central role in public administration at the provincial level. The position combines administrative leadership, representation of the state, and connecting authority between different administrative levels. The King's Commissioner chairs both the Provincial Council and the Provincial Executive and monitors the administrative process, the quality of decision-making, and the mutual relationships within the provincial government. In doing so, the CdK ensures careful, transparent, and democratic proceedings of meetings and decision-making. As a state body, the King's Commissioner represents the Kingdom in the province. In this role, he or she functions as a link between the province and the national government, and oversees the implementation of national laws and regulations within the province. The CdK also has a coordinating role in special situations, such as crises, disasters, and security issues. The King's Commissioner maintains intensive contacts with municipalities, water boards, social organizations, the business community, and other public partners. The position requires connecting diverse interests and promoting cooperation within the region. The CdK stimulates regional development, administrative coherence, and long-term vision on provincial challenges. Additionally, the King's Commissioner plays a role in appointment and reappointment procedures for mayors and serves as a contact point and confidential advisor for mayors within the province. The position also has a representative character: the King's Commissioner represents the province at official occasions and contributes to the positioning and profiling of the province, both nationally and internationally.

Career Perspective

You typically reach this top position after a long career in politics, public administration, or as mayor of a large municipality. As King's Commissioner, you're at the pinnacle of your career, but you can advance to roles such as minister, state secretary, or chair of important government bodies. The position offers excellent networking opportunities and often serves as a stepping stone to national political functions or advisory roles with international organizations. With the increasing complexity of provincial issues, there remains demand for experienced administrators.
